Rookie Minors

Rookie Minors is the next step transitioning players towards the Minors division. This division stresses skills development, peer pitching and more “real game experience.” Unlike Minors, where players pitch to each other from a full 46 foot mound, a closer 38 foot pitching distance is used. After 3 called balls, the batting team’s coach will pitch. No batter walks. Batters either hit or strike out.

Who can play?

  • “League Age” 7 – 10 years old
  • New and experienced players are welcome
  • Players are selected through mandatory assessments to ensure teams have balanced skill levels

What is included?

  • A hat and t-shirt style jersey that players get to keep!
  • A team/individual photo
  • Use of basic playing equipment (bats, catchers gear)

What is required?

  • Jock/Jill (groin protection)
  • Glove
  • Grey baseball pants
  • A batting helmet

Other recommended items include cleats

Parent Expectations

Parents are expected to help with the following:

  • Field set up and take down
  • Scorekeeping (one scorekeeper from each team is required for a game to be played)
  • Helping the coach: Dugout manager or base coach during games; first baseman, catcher etc. during practices

The team manager will ask for volunteers and set up a parent volunteer schedule

Team Schedule

Games:
1 – 2 per week. Games are interlock, which means played against both other National teams and Little Leagues throughout Greater Victoria (Beacon Hill, Hampton, Lakehill, Layritz, and Central Saanich)
Practices:
1 – 2 per week as set by the head coach
